1
Alumno: Lidia San Emeterio Arroyo
Consultor: Ferran Prados Carrasco
Curso: 2012/2013-1
2
1.-1.- Introducción
2.-2.- Objetivos
3.-3.- Viabilidad
4.-4.- Marco de trabajo
5.- Requisitos
6.- Aplicación web6.- Aplicación web
7.- Demostración7.- Demostración
Índice de la presentaciónÍndice de la presentación
3
1.- Introducción1.- Introducción
Aplicaciones web para trabajo colaborativo
Aplicación web para la corrección automática de pruebas
5
2.- Objetivos2.- Objetivos
Aplicaciones web para trabajo colaborativo
Aplicación web para la corrección automática de pruebas
7
3.- Viabilidad3.- Viabilidad
Aplicaciones web para trabajo colaborativo
Aplicación web para la corrección automática de pruebas
8Introducción Objetivos ViabilidadMarco de trabajo
Requisitos Aplicación web
HardwareHardware
Máquina: HP Pavilion dv6; Intel Core i7 Q720 @1.6GHz; RAM 4GBMáquina: HP Pavilion dv6; Intel Core i7 Q720 @1.6GHz; RAM 4GB
Sistema operativo: Windows 7 64 bitsSistema operativo: Windows 7 64 bits
PresupuestoPresupuesto
Se considera 0. La “cifra” que se recibirá del “cliente” será la nota ;-)Se considera 0. La “cifra” que se recibirá del “cliente” será la nota ;-)
ServidorServidorApache 2.x, PHP 5.3, MySQL 5.0Apache 2.x, PHP 5.3, MySQL 5.0
SoftwareSoftwareEclipse, phpMyAdmin, Subversion, navegador web, OpenOfficeEclipse, phpMyAdmin, Subversion, navegador web, OpenOffice
9
4.- Marco de trabajo4.- Marco de trabajo
Aplicaciones web para trabajo colaborativo
Aplicación web para la corrección automática de pruebas
11
5.- Requisitos5.- Requisitos
Aplicaciones web para trabajo colaborativo
Aplicación web para la corrección automática de pruebas
12Introducción Objetivos ViabilidadMarco de trabajo
Requisitos Aplicación webIntroducción Objetivos ViabilidadMarco de trabajo
Requisitos Aplicación web
Requisitos no funcionalesRequisitos no funcionales
Rendimiento:Rendimiento: Concurrencia de usuarios. Tiempo de respuesta rápido. Concurrencia de usuarios. Tiempo de respuesta rápido.
Seguridad: Seguridad: Acceso restringido. Control de acceso. Roles.Acceso restringido. Control de acceso. Roles.
Usabilidad:Usabilidad: Interfaz sencilla e intuitiva. Diseño básico. Interfaz sencilla e intuitiva. Diseño básico.
Accesibilidad:Accesibilidad: Cumplimiento de la especificación WCAG 2.0. Cumplimiento de la especificación WCAG 2.0.
Requisitos funcionalesRequisitos funcionalesActores:Actores: Administrador. Profesor. Alumno. Administrador. Profesor. Alumno.
Casos de uso: Casos de uso: Áreas Aulas Usuarios Preguntas Examen Estadísticas
CrearEditarListarAsociar aula
CrearEditarListarAsociar usuarioAsociar área
CrearEditarListarAsociar aula
CrearEditarListar
CrearEditarListarAsignar prueba
AulaÁreaExamenPregunta Alumno
13
6.- Aplicación web6.- Aplicación web
Aplicaciones web para trabajo colaborativo
Aplicación web para la corrección automática de pruebas
14Introducción Objetivos ViabilidadMarco de trabajo
Requisitos Aplicación webIntroducción Objetivos ViabilidadMarco de trabajo
Requisitos Aplicación web
http://tfc-uoc.freeiz.com/tfc_uoc/
Usuarios genéricosUsuarios genéricos
usuario password
admin admin
teacher1 teacher
student1 student
15
7.- Demostración7.- Demostración
Aplicaciones web para trabajo colaborativo
Aplicación web para la corrección automática de pruebas